Understanding Traditional Contracts: An Overview

Traditional contracts have been around for centuries, serving as a foundational element of legal agreements. They are typically paper-based documents that require signatures from all involved parties to be considered valid. The essence of a traditional contract lies in its enforceability, which is upheld by legal systems and can involve courts for dispute resolution.

These contracts often include terms and conditions, obligations, and rights of the parties involved, clearly outlined to prevent misunderstandings. They rely heavily on mutual trust and the legal frameworks that govern them, meaning any breach can lead to litigation. In essence, traditional contracts are built on a foundation of trust and legal recourse.

What Are Smart Contracts? A Brief Introduction

Smart contracts are digital agreements coded into blockchain technology, designed to execute automatically when predetermined conditions are met. Unlike traditional contracts, they don't require intermediaries, which can significantly speed up the execution process. Think of them as self-operating agreements that run on a 'if-then' basis, ensuring efficiency and reliability.

For example, in a real estate transaction, a smart contract could automatically transfer ownership once payment is confirmed. This automation reduces the chances of human error or manipulation, making transactions more secure. Moreover, once deployed on the blockchain, smart contracts are immutable, meaning they cannot be altered without consensus from all parties involved.

Key Differences in Execution Speed and Efficiency

One of the most significant differences between smart contracts and traditional contracts is their execution speed. Smart contracts can execute transactions within seconds or minutes, as they automatically trigger when conditions are met. In contrast, traditional contracts can take days or even weeks to finalize due to the need for manual review and approval from various parties.

Trust and Transparency: A Comparative Look

Trust is a fundamental element in any contractual agreement, but it is approached differently in smart contracts and traditional contracts. Traditional contracts rely on the trustworthiness of the parties involved and the legal system to enforce the agreement. If a party breaches the contract, it may lead to legal disputes, which can be time-consuming and costly.

In contrast, smart contracts are inherently trustless, meaning that parties do not need to rely on each other’s integrity. Instead, they trust the technology itself. The use of blockchain ensures that once a smart contract is deployed, the terms cannot be altered, providing a transparent and secure environment for all parties involved.

Cost Implications: Which is More Affordable?

When considering the financial aspects, smart contracts often present a more cost-effective solution compared to traditional contracts. The elimination of intermediaries, such as lawyers and notaries, reduces transaction costs significantly. For businesses, this can translate into substantial savings, especially for high-volume or repetitive transactions.

However, it’s important to note that deploying smart contracts does involve upfront costs related to blockchain technology and potential programming fees. Organizations must invest in developing the code and ensuring its security before they can reap the benefits. This initial investment can be a barrier for smaller businesses or those unfamiliar with blockchain.

Legal recognition of smart contracts varies widely across jurisdictions, which can create uncertainty for businesses looking to adopt this technology. In many regions, traditional contracts have well-established legal frameworks that provide clear guidance on enforcement and dispute resolution. However, smart contracts are still navigating the complexities of legal acceptance.

Some countries have begun to recognize smart contracts as legally binding, provided they meet certain criteria. For instance, they must be created with clear terms and conditions, similar to traditional contracts. However, the lack of comprehensive legislation can lead to ambiguity, making businesses hesitant to fully embrace smart contracts.

Use Cases: When to Choose Smart Contracts Over Traditional Ones

Smart contracts shine in scenarios that require automation, speed, and transparency. Industries like finance, real estate, and supply chain management are increasingly leveraging smart contracts to streamline processes and reduce costs. For example, in supply chain management, smart contracts can automatically execute payments upon delivery confirmations, ensuring a smooth flow of goods and services.

On the other hand, traditional contracts may be more suitable for complex agreements involving nuanced negotiations, such as mergers and acquisitions. These transactions often require detailed discussions and modifications that a rigid smart contract may not easily accommodate. In such cases, the flexibility of a traditional contract could prove more beneficial.
